Overview of Low Voltage Transformers

Transformator 220V 240V Input 110V Output Low Voltage AC Single Phase Power Transformer is critical power equipment that uses the axiom of electromagnetic induction to convert AC voltage, including voltage, current, impedance conversion, isolation, and stability functions. It usually consists of three parts: primary coil, secondary coil, and iron core (or magnetic core). Low-voltage transformers are widely used in power systems for voltage regulation, impedance matching, and safety isolation. It is also commonly used in various electronic devices and circuits, such as audio devices, TV receivers, computer power supplies, etc., to achieve functions such as voltage, current, and impedance conversion. In addition, low-voltage transformers also play an essential role in safety, preventing excessive recent or circuit failures from posing a threat to equipment or personal safety and protecting equipment from harmful effects such as sudden power changes and surge currnts.

Features of Low Voltage Transformers

Small size, low power, easy installation, suitable for low-power equipment and short distance power transmission.

Not using oil as an insulation medium is more environmentally friendly.

Has excellent moisture and corrosion resistance, suitable for harsh working environments.

Strong isolation, with high safety and reliability.

No need for oil inspection, filling, and replacement, reducing maintenance costs and workload.

Low magnetization current, low noise, low temperature rise, stable performance and high efficiency.

5 FAQs of Transformator 220V 240V Input 110V Output Low Voltage AC Single Phase Power Transformer

What is this transformer for?
It safely steps down higher voltage electricity. Use it with 220V or 240V power sources. It gives you a stable 110V output. This powers 110V appliances safely in areas with higher voltage.

Is it safe for my electronics?
Yes it is. It has built-in protection against overheating. It follows international safety standards. This prevents damage to your connected devices. Always check your appliance’s power needs match the transformer’s output.

What devices can I connect?
Connect standard 110V AC equipment. Common uses are for power tools, lighting, and some audio gear. Check the wattage rating first. The transformer has a maximum load capacity. Do not exceed its rated wattage.

How do I wire it?
Connect the input wires to your 220V/240V supply. Use the correct terminals marked clearly. Connect your 110V device to the output terminals. Ensure all connections are tight and secure. Consult an electrician if you are unsure.

Can it overheat?
All transformers get warm during normal use. This one includes thermal protection. It shuts down automatically if it gets too hot. Let it cool down before restarting. Ensure it has good airflow around it. Do not cover it while operating.
